Governor: Martinsville Flooding Under Control
Last updated on Saturday, June 14, 2008
(MARTINSVILLE) - Even as rain poured down in Martinsville Friday, Gov. Mitch Daniels proclaimed the state has flooding under control.
Daniels said experts had told him that places affected by the floods would absorb a few more inches of rain.
On Friday, 14 more Indiana counties were declared eligible for federal storm aid. In all, 22 counties have been designated.
